It’s called Blog Evangelists and it’s a ‘fixed term membership site’ that I’ve launched in response to what I’ve been learning from Jimmy D. Brown’s Membernaire program.

BE will teach members how to launch a local blog design company, whether as an actual designer or as a consultant who outsources all the tech to others.  Over a period of 12 months we’ll take our Blog Evangelists through the paces of building their own unique business teaching their local business community the value of Web 2.0 websites – developing clients and residual income along the way.

I believe BE is perfect for blog lovers because they’re always trying to talk someone else into starting their own blog anyways – why not turn that passion into a business? It’s also going to be great for virtual assistants who want to build more local clientèle.
